Forståelse af Matricer
En matrix er en todimensionel datastruktur, hvor hvert element identificeres ved sin række- og kolonneposition, og elementerne skal være af samme datatyper.
I R kan matricer oprettes på forskellige måder. De mest almindelige er ved at sammenflette vektorer som rækker eller ved at sammenflette dem som kolonner.
Oprettelse af matrix fra rækker
Du kan oprette en matrix ved at kombinere vektorer som rækker med funktionen rbind()
.
Eksempel
12345row_1 = c(1, 2, 3) row_2 = c(4, 5, 6) # Bind rows into a matrix rbind(row_1, row_2)
Dette giver en matrix med to rækker og tre kolonner.
Oprettelse af matrix fra kolonner
Alternativt kan du oprette en matrix ved at kombinere vektorer som kolonner med funktionen cbind()
.
Eksempel
12345col_1 = c(1, 2, 3) col_2 = c(4, 5, 6) # Bind columns into a matrix cbind(col_1, col_2)
Dette giver en matrix med tre rækker og to kolonner.
Swipe to start coding
- Opret to vektorer:
a
med heltal fra1
til4
;b
med heltal fra5
til8
. Brug kolon (:
) syntaksen for et interval.
- Opret og vis en matrix ved at sammenflette
a
ogb
som rækker. - Opret og vis en matrix ved at sammenflette
a
ogb
som kolonner.
Løsning
Tak for dine kommentarer!
single
Spørg AI
Spørg AI
Spørg om hvad som helst eller prøv et af de foreslåede spørgsmål for at starte vores chat
Can you explain the difference between rbind() and cbind() in more detail?
How can I access specific elements in a matrix in R?
Can you show how to name the rows and columns of a matrix?
Awesome!
Completion rate improved to 2.27
Forståelse af Matricer
Stryg for at vise menuen
En matrix er en todimensionel datastruktur, hvor hvert element identificeres ved sin række- og kolonneposition, og elementerne skal være af samme datatyper.
I R kan matricer oprettes på forskellige måder. De mest almindelige er ved at sammenflette vektorer som rækker eller ved at sammenflette dem som kolonner.
Oprettelse af matrix fra rækker
Du kan oprette en matrix ved at kombinere vektorer som rækker med funktionen rbind()
.
Eksempel
12345row_1 = c(1, 2, 3) row_2 = c(4, 5, 6) # Bind rows into a matrix rbind(row_1, row_2)
Dette giver en matrix med to rækker og tre kolonner.
Oprettelse af matrix fra kolonner
Alternativt kan du oprette en matrix ved at kombinere vektorer som kolonner med funktionen cbind()
.
Eksempel
12345col_1 = c(1, 2, 3) col_2 = c(4, 5, 6) # Bind columns into a matrix cbind(col_1, col_2)
Dette giver en matrix med tre rækker og to kolonner.
Swipe to start coding
- Opret to vektorer:
a
med heltal fra1
til4
;b
med heltal fra5
til8
. Brug kolon (:
) syntaksen for et interval.
- Opret og vis en matrix ved at sammenflette
a
ogb
som rækker. - Opret og vis en matrix ved at sammenflette
a
ogb
som kolonner.
Løsning
Tak for dine kommentarer!
single